A business loan in Delhi is a financial solution that helps business owners access funds to manage daily expenses, maintain cash flow, or expand operations. It is commonly used for working capital needs such as purchasing stock, paying salaries, or handling urgent business requirements.

In a fast-paced market like Delhi, businesses often operate on tight cash cycles where delays in funding can directly impact operations. Shopkeepers, traders, and small business owners frequently need quick access to capital to keep their business running smoothly.

While traditional bank loans are available, they usually involve strict eligibility criteria and longer approval timelines. As a result, many businesses in Delhi now prefer faster and more flexible options that focus on real business activity rather than just credit scores. These modern financing solutions are designed to provide quick access to funds with minimal disruption to day-to-day operations.

Types of Business Loans in Delhi

Businesses in Delhi can choose from different types of business loans depending on their requirements, urgency, and eligibility. Each option comes with its own process, flexibility, and approval criteria.

Traditional bank loans are generally suitable for well-established businesses with strong financial records. They offer lower interest rates but require high CIBIL scores, detailed documentation, and longer approval timelines. Government-backed schemes like MSME or Mudra loans also fall under this category, offering structured funding but with a formal and time-consuming process.

NBFCs provide a more flexible alternative. They process loans faster than banks and have slightly relaxed requirements, but approval still depends on credit profile and business history.

Instant business loans have become a practical option for many Delhi business owners who need quick funding. These loans are designed for speed, minimal paperwork, and faster approvals. Instead of relying only on credit scores, lenders often evaluate business performance, such as turnover and daily operations.

To understand the difference clearly:

  • Bank Loans: Lower interest rates, but strict eligibility and slower approvals
  • NBFC Loans: Faster processing with moderate flexibility
  • Instant Business Loans: Quick approval, minimal documentation, and designed for urgent business needs

For many small businesses in Delhi, especially those dealing with daily cash flow, faster and more flexible loan options are often more suitable than traditional financing routes.

Who Can Get a Business Loan in Delhi?

Eligibility for a business loan in Delhi depends on the type of lender you choose. Traditional banks usually have stricter requirements, while modern lenders focus more on actual business performance.

Banks typically require a strong CIBIL score, consistent financial records, and at least 2–3 years of business history. This can make it difficult for small or growing businesses to qualify, especially if their credit profile is not strong.

However, many lenders today offer more flexible eligibility criteria, making it easier for a wider range of businesses in Delhi to access funding. Instead of relying only on credit score, they consider how the business is currently performing.

In most cases, you can qualify if:

  • Your business has been operational for at least 6 months
  • You have a minimum monthly turnover of around ₹1,00,000
  • You are a proprietor, partner, or director of the business
  • Your business is based in Delhi NCR
  • You have an active bank account

This approach allows shopkeepers, traders, and small business owners in Delhi to access funds even if they do not meet strict banking criteria. Many lenders now assess business stability and cash flow rather than depending entirely on past credit history.

Loan Amount, Tenure & Repayment Options in Delhi

Business loan terms in Delhi can vary depending on the lender, but most options today are designed to match the cash flow needs of small and mid-sized businesses.

Typically, loan amounts range from ₹50,000 to ₹1 crore, allowing businesses to choose funding based on their immediate requirement—whether it’s managing daily expenses or scaling operations.

Unlike traditional long-term loans, many modern lenders offer short-term financing options. The usual tenure ranges from 3 to 6 months (100 to 180 days), with some flexibility extending up to 240 days in special cases. This shorter duration helps businesses avoid long-term financial burden and repay quickly as revenue cycles stabilize.

Repayment is also designed to be flexible and aligned with daily business income. Instead of fixed monthly EMIs, many lenders allow:

  • Daily repayments
  • Weekly repayments
  • Fortnightly repayments (every 15 days)

Another key advantage is that these loans are often unsecured, meaning no collateral is required. The process is typically simple and may involve cheque-based or streamlined approval systems, making funding quicker and more accessible.

For many Delhi-based businesses, especially those with regular cash inflow, these flexible repayment options make it easier to manage loans without putting pressure on operations.

Documents Required & How to Apply for a Business Loan in Delhi

One of the key advantages of modern business loans in Delhi is the simplified documentation and quick application process. Unlike traditional bank loans that require extensive paperwork, many lenders now focus on essential documents to speed up approval.

To apply, you typically need:

  • Identity proof: PAN card or Aadhaar card
  • Address proof: Utility bill or similar document
  • Business proof: GST registration or Shop Establishment certificate
  • Bank statements: Last 6 months of business or personal account

Once the documents are ready, the application process is straightforward and designed for speed.

The usual steps include:

  • Submitting basic business details through an application form
  • Connecting with a representative for verification
  • Quick review and approval of the application
  • Loan disbursal, often within 24 hours of approval

This streamlined process makes it easier for business owners in Delhi to access funds without delays or complicated procedures. It is especially useful for those who need immediate financial support to manage operations or take advantage of business opportunities.

How to Choose the Right Business Loan in Delhi

Choosing the right business loan in Delhi depends on your urgency, business profile, and repayment capacity.

Bank loans are suitable for long-term needs if you have strong financials, but they come with strict criteria and slower approvals. NBFC loans offer a faster alternative with moderate flexibility.

For urgent requirements or fast-moving businesses, instant business loans are often more practical. They offer quick approvals, minimal documentation, and flexible repayment options.

Before deciding, consider:

  • How quickly you need funds
  • Your cash flow and repayment ability
  • The documentation required

For many Delhi businesses, choosing a loan that matches real-time needs and offers speed and flexibility can make operations much smoother.
